問題タブ [probability-density]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
801 参照

matlab - ヒストグラム (hist) がゼロで開始 (および終了) しない

私が持っているランダムプロセスの実現の確率密度関数を推定するために、Matlab 関数「hist」を使用しています。

私は実際には:

1) h0 のヒストグラムを取る

2) 1 を得るためにその面積を正規化する

3) 正規化された曲線をプロットします。

問題は、使用するビンの数に関係なく、ヒストグラムが 0 から開始されず、0 に戻らないことですが、そのような動作が本当に好きです。

私が使用するコードは次のとおりです。

そして、私が得るプロットは次のとおりです。 ここに画像の説明を入力

ここに画像の説明を入力

0 投票する
1 に答える
156 参照

opencv - 任意の連続確率密度に従ってサンプルを生成する

連続確率変数の既知の確率密度があります。C++ で OpenCV を使用して、この確率密度に従うポイントを生成するにはどうすればよいですか? つまり、RNG::uniform が行うことを実行したいのですが、任意の確率分布が必要です。前もって感謝します。

0 投票する
3 に答える
10522 参照

matlab - 距離を確率に変換するには?

誰でも私の matlab プログラムに光を当てることができますか? 2 つのセンサーからのデータがありkNN、それぞれを個別に分類しています。どちらの場合も、トレーニング セットは次のように合計 42 行のベクトルのセットのように見えます。

次に、サンプルを取得します。たとえば[40 30 50 25 40 25 30]、サンプルを最も近い隣人に分類したいと思います。近接の基準として、ユークリッド メトリックsqrt(sum(Y 2 ))を使用します。ここYで、 は各要素の差であり、サンプルとトレーニング セットの各クラスの間の距離の配列が得られます。

だから、2つの質問:

  • クラス 1: 60%、クラス 2: 30%、クラス 3: 5%、クラス 5: 1% などのように、距離を確率の分布に変換することは可能ですか?

追加: 今までは Formula: を使用していますが、正しいヒストグラムまたはヒストグラムprobability = distance/sum of distancesをプロットできません。cdfこれにより、何らかの方法で分布が得られますが、そこに問題があります。距離が大きい場合、たとえば 700 の場合、最も近いクラスが最大の確率になりますが、距離が大きすぎて正しくないためです。どのクラスと比べても。

  • 2 つの確率密度関数を取得できる場合は、それらの積を計算すると思います。出来ますか?

どんな助けや発言も大歓迎です。

0 投票する
1 に答える
11825 参照

r - R のカイ 2 乗の密度グラフ

28 df が 7.5 までの x であるカイ 2 乗分布の密度関数のグラフを R でプロットしようとしています。

今まで、私が集めてきたものからこれを得ました:

しかし、プロットは機能していないようです._.